概括
葡萄种子益氨基胺提取物 (GSPE) 通过改善淋巴功能和血液流动,显著减少了大鼠的二次淋巴. 这表明GSPE可能是这种衰弱的疾病的有希望的治疗方法.

背景情况:
- 二次性淋巴 (SLE) 是一种慢性疾病,通常是癌症治疗的结果,目前没有有效的药理疗法.
- 葡萄种子的普朗索亚尼丁提取物 (GSPE),以静脉功能不充分治疗而闻名,因其在SLE中改善淋巴功能的潜力而受到探索.
- 这项研究调查了GSPE在老鼠模型中的有效性,以解决对SLE治疗的未满足需求.
研究的目的:
- 评估葡萄种子前素提取物 (GSPE) 在二次淋巴瘤 (SLE) 的小鼠模型中的治疗疗效.
- 评估GSPE对SLE淋巴功能,血流和组织病理学的影响.
- 确定GSPE是否为SLE提供了潜在的药理干预.
主要方法:
- 在Sprague-Dawley大鼠手术诱导的尾部淋巴,治疗组接受GSPE,对照组接受盐水.
- 通过尾巴体积测量来监测胀的进展.
- 评估淋巴和血液流动,分别使用近红外光淋巴血管学 (NIRF-ICGL) 和激光多普勒流量计成像 (LDFI),以及组织学分析.
主要成果:
- 与对照组相比,GSPE治疗导致尾部明显减少.
- 在接受了GSPE治疗的老鼠中观察到改善的淋巴疏通和增强的血液输液.
- 组织学分析显示,细胞外基质沉积减少,淋巴异常减少,表明纤维化和功能障碍的缓解.
结论:
- GSPE在二次淋巴瘤中显示出显著的治疗潜力.
- 提取物改善淋巴排水,组织 perfusion,并减少病态组织变化.
- 鉴于目前缺乏有效的治疗方法,GSPE代表了未来SLE管理临床试验的有希望的候选人.

Lymphatic Vessels and Lymph Transport
10.0K
Lymphatic vessels, known as lymphatics, are crucial in transporting lymph from peripheral tissues to our venous system. This process begins with lymph entering through tiny capillaries that branch through tissues. These capillaries have unique features such as larger diameters, thinner walls, and a distinctive one-way valve system formed by overlapping endothelial cells.

Development of the Lymphatic System
1.0K
The development of lymphatic tissues and vessels in embryonic life begins around the fifth week. These structures originate from the mesoderm layer, with lymph sacs emerging from developing veins.
The first lymph sacs to form are the paired jugular lymph sacs located at the junction of the internal jugular and subclavian veins.
